Subject: Relevance tuning cut-over done — Searchpool

Hey, quick heads-up before your shift: we cut Searchpool over to the new relevance weights tonight. Queries look healthy, latency flat. If rankings go weird, the old profile is still deployable from the tuning repo. The live values after the switch are pasted below.

deployment values, kajep-kageg:
[praix]
host = praix.paliqcorp.corp
user = praix_svc
database = praix_prod

Welcome aboard. Millwheel Bakery's ordering system enforces a hard cutoff at 14:00 for next-day wholesale orders. Normally this rule cannot be bypassed, because the bakehouse schedules flour and staffing from the locked order list. In rare cases — a hospital kitchen emergency, or a system outage that blocked customers from ordering — a contractor with override rights may reopen the order window for up to 30 minutes. Log every override in the ledger. To activate the override panel, enter the recovery passphrase below.

recovery phrase for bawef-haduf: wenax-druox-julmir

Escalation Path: Query Planner Regression (Corvid DB)

If a release of Corvid DB shows planner regressions — full scans replacing index lookups, or latency doubling on review workloads — file a severity-two ticket and attach the plan diffs. Security reviewers should note that regressed plans may bypass row-level filters in rare cases, which elevates priority to severity one. Freeze further schema migrations until triage completes. Escalations outside business hours go straight to the planner maintainers at the address below.

escalation mailbox, hadug-bajog: sormir@norvalabs.internal